- 博客(21)
- 收藏
- 关注
![](https://csdnimg.cn/release/blogv2/dist/pc/img/listFixedTop.png)
原创 详解hadoop+zookeeper+kafka集群搭建
hadoop+zookeeper+kafka集群搭建http://note.youdao.com/s/GtU1edbP
2020-11-18 11:04:14
148
原创 rabbitmq常用命令
启动方式1systemctl start rabbitmq-server启动方式2rabbitmq-server -detached集群模式启动rabbitmqctl start_app开启web管理插件rabbitmq-plugins enable rabbitmq_management查看集群rabbitmqctl cluster_status查看所有用户rabbitmqctl list_users添加一个新用户rabbitmq
2021-11-08 15:20:07
1224
原创 阿里云服务器迁移到其他主体(公网ip不变)
1. 制作现有服务器镜像共享给目标账户(如果实例是经典网络先迁移专有网络再做镜像)2. 购买新服务器并使用自定义镜像,使用共享的镜像(新服务器不要选择公网带宽 )3. 调试新服务器并完成环境测试(使用阿里云自带ssh面版私网连接)4. 源服务器改为按量计费,转换固定带宽为EIP(按量的带宽可以直接转EIP)5.eip过户到新服务器(需要提工单过户eip)6、检查服务器运行情况(服务启动、域名解析、网络端口等)绑定ECS实例 - 弹性公网 IP - 阿里云使用快照创建自定义...
2021-11-08 15:17:12
3141
原创 解决mysql无法启动ERROR 2002 (HY000): Can‘t connect to local MySQL server through socket ‘/tmp/mysql.sock‘
错误信息:ERROR 2002 (HY000): Can't connect to local MySQL server through socket '/tmp/mysql.sock' (2)出现问题原因:有可能是 my.cnf 配置文件中设置了 [mysqld] 的参数 socket ,而没有设置[client]的参数socketmysql.sock 文件有什么用:mysql 支持 socket 和 TCP/IP 连接。那么 mysql.sock 这个文件有什么用呢?连接loca
2021-11-08 15:10:12
614
原创 aws证书绑定godaddy
#aws绑定godaddy证书#godaddy证书帮助在我的 AWS 服务器上手动安装 SSL 证书 | SSL 证书 - GoDaddy 帮助 SG1、打开aws-ssl后台,如果证书到期,点击原有证书进行重新绑定2、pem填入服务器上的key3、crt填入godaddy#godaddy通配符证书文件#aws配置证书信息面板...
2021-11-08 15:02:52
476
原创 docker常用命令
Docker常用命令1、镜像命令docker images 查看所有本地的主机上的镜像docker images -a 列出所有镜像docker images -q 只显示镜像的iddocker search mysql 搜索镜像docker pull mysql 下载默认最新版本镜像docker pull masql:5.7 下载镜像指定版本docker rmi -f id 通过镜像id删除docker rmi -f id id id
2021-11-08 14:58:13
351
原创 解决npm install 失败问题
npm install 失败问题总结:1、gyp ERR! configure error解决:npm install --unsafe-permnpm 出于安全考虑不支持以 root 用户运行,即使你用 root 用户身份运行了,npm 会自动转成一个叫 nobody 的用户来运行,而这个用户几乎没有任何权限。这样的话如果你脚本里有一些需要权限的操作,比如写文件(尤其是写 /root/.node-gyp),就会崩掉了。为了避免这种情况,要么按照 npm 的规矩来,专门建一个..
2021-04-25 17:11:55
8884
4
原创 Linux部署tomcat发布web应用
文档:tomcat链接:http://note.youdao.com/noteshare?id=57ef92649b9f5fcd8b0795e9d9c2b9a8
2020-07-09 10:29:45
91
原创 Ansible-playbook语法框架详解
文档:Ansible-playbook.note链接:http://note.youdao.com/noteshare?id=67322139f54ef49eb9e276b14e761c02&sub=C8E0EEBC6C08485E837C61CA89B85475
2020-06-08 14:42:47
297
原创 Linux_centso-7系统初始化脚本shell
#!/bin/bashecho "+-----------------------------+| Tools |+-----------------------------+| 1.修改默认官方yum源 || 2.修改为aliyun_repo || 3.安装常用命令 || 4.安装epel源 || 5.安装nginx服务 || ...
2020-06-08 14:37:31
175
原创 关于ansible主机验证ping客户机无法验证的问题
1.首先定义好主机清单:vim /etc/ansible/hosts2.取消key密钥验证:vim /etc/ansible/ansible.cfg取消注释:host_key_checking = False3.开启日志记录:vim /etc/ansible/ansible.cfg取消注释:log_path = /var/log/ansible.log4.再次登录直接按回车不用输密钥为了安全起见建议每次登陆做完工作删除日志记录rm -rf ....
2020-06-08 14:22:35
670
原创 shell_键盘读入IPping回显结果
#!/usr/bin/bash#Author: SHI#Created Time: 2020/05/22#Script Description: IP reachable shell#定义IPping的方式为键盘读入read ip#ping一次且不显示过程ping -c1 $ip &>/dev/null#加入if语句框架(判断ping的结果)if [ $? -eq 0 ]; then echo "$ip is up."...
2020-05-22 11:23:17
429
原创 shell脚本_查看CPU、内存信息
#!/usr/bin/bash#Author: SHI#Created Time: 2020/05/15#Script Description: system information shellPS3="请选择:"select choice in cpu_load mem_util quitdo case "$choice" in cpu_load) uptime ;; mem_util) fre...
2020-05-21 14:53:20
447
原创 shell脚本_随机点名
#!/bin/bash#该脚本,需要提前准备一个 user.txt 文件#该文件中需要包含所有姓名的信息,一行一个姓名,脚本每次随机显示一个姓名while :do#统计 user 文件中有多少用户 line=`cat user.txt |wc -l` num=$[RANDOM%line+1] sed -n "${num}p" user.txt #输出第num行 sleep 0.2 clear #清屏done...
2020-05-21 14:51:01
1502
2
原创 shell脚本_切换用户登录
#!/bin/bash#Author: SHI#Created Time: 2020/05/09#Script Description: Host login shell#清屏clear#输入用户名echo -n -e "Login: "read#输入密码echo -n -e "Password: "read=====================================================...
2020-05-21 14:48:53
421
原创 常见的HTT相应状态码
常见的HTT相应状态码200:请求被正常处理204:请求被受理但没有资源可以返回206:客户端只是请求资源的一部分,服务器只对请求的部分资源执行GET方法,相应报文中通过Content-Range指定范围的资源301:永久性重定向302:临时性重定向303:与302状态码有相似功能。只是它希望客户端请求一个URI的时候,能通过GET方法重定向到另一个URI上304:发送附带条件的请求时,条件不满足时返回,与重定向无关307:临时重定向,与302类似400:请求报文语法有误
2020-05-21 14:46:54
892
原创 too many open files错误与解决方法
"too many open files" 错误与解决方法问题现象:这是一个基于 java 的 web 应用系统,在后台添加数据时提示无法添加,于是登陆服务器查看 tomcat 日志,发现如下异常信息:java.io.IOException: Too many open files通过这个报错信息,基本判断是系统可以用的文件描述符不够了,由于 tomcat 服务室系统 www 用户启动的,于是以 www 用户登陆系统...
2020-05-21 14:45:06
1355
原创 Read-only file system 错误与解决方法
Read-only file system 错误与解决方法解析:出现这个问题的原因有很多种,可能是文件系统数据块出现不一致导致的,也可能是磁盘故障造成的,主流 ext3/ext4 文件系统都有很强的自我修复机制,对于简单的错误,文件系统一般都可以自行修复,当遇到致命错误无法修复的时候,文件系统为了保证数据一致性和安全,会暂时屏蔽文件系统的写操作,将文件系统 变为只读,今儿出现了上面的 “read-only file system” 现象。手工修复文件系统错误的命令...
2020-05-21 14:43:35
4697
原创 文件已经删除,但是空间没有释放的原因
运维监控系统发来通知,报告一台服务器空间满了,登陆服务器查看,根分区确实满了,这里先说一下服务器的一些删除策略,由于 linux 没有回收站功能,所以线上服务器上所有要删除的文件都会先移到系统 /tmp 目录下,然后定期清除 /tmp 目录下的数据。这个策略本身没有什么问题,但是通过检查发现这台服务器的系统分区中并没有单独划分 /tmp 分区,这样 /tmp 下的数据其实占用根分区的空间,既然找到了问题,那么删除 /tmp 目录下一些占用空间较大的数据文件即可。# du -sh /tm...
2020-05-20 14:55:45
2097
原创 inode 耗尽导致应用故障
客户的一台 Oracle 数据库如武器在关机重启后,Oracle 监听无法启动,提示报错 Linux error : No space left on device从输出信息看出来是因为磁盘耗尽导致监听无法启动,因为 Oracle 在启动监听时需要创建监听日志文件,于是首先查看磁盘空间使用情况# df -h从磁盘输出信息可知,所有的分区磁盘空间都还有剩余不少,而 Oracle 监听写日志的路径在 /var 分区下,/var 下分区空间足够。解决思路:既...
2020-05-20 14:54:26
234
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人